Best Dreadnought Guitars With Mahogany Sides in 2024

Here are the top Dreadnought style guitars with Mahogany sides. This is the type of wood found in many top-of-the-line guitars, so that's a positive point for the build quality. This red-looking wood Mahogany is found in Africa and Central America and has great sustain and a warm tone due to its high density. The downside about this type of wood is that it's relatively heavy.
